How Wool Shrinks and What Causes It

Wool fibers have a unique structure that makes them particularly susceptible to shrinking when exposed to certain conditions. The outer layer of wool fibers is covered with tiny scales, which interlock when agitated in the presence of heat and moisture. This phenomenon is known as felting shrinkage.

When wool socks are washed or dried improperly, the scales on the fibers open and catch onto each other, causing the fibers to tighten and the fabric to contract. This process is irreversible and results in the sock becoming smaller and denser. Key factors that contribute to wool shrinkage include:

  • Heat: Warm or hot water and drying temperatures cause the wool fibers to swell and the scales to lift.
  • Agitation: Mechanical action during washing or drying encourages the scales to lock together.
  • Moisture: Water allows the fibers to move more freely, facilitating the felting process.
  • Chemical exposure: Harsh detergents or bleach can damage the fiber surface, increasing shrinkage risk.

Understanding these factors helps in managing wool sock care to avoid unwanted shrinkage.

Effective Care Practices to Prevent Shrinkage

Proper care is essential to maintain the size and longevity of wool socks. Following these guidelines can significantly reduce the risk of shrinkage:

  • Wash in cold water: Use cold or lukewarm water to prevent fiber swelling.
  • Use gentle detergents: Mild or wool-specific detergents protect the fiber scales.
  • Avoid excessive agitation: Hand washing or using a gentle cycle minimizes fiber interlocking.
  • Air dry flat: Lay socks flat to dry naturally, avoiding heat from dryers.
  • Avoid bleach and fabric softeners: These chemicals can degrade wool fibers and promote shrinkage.

By implementing these practices, you preserve the natural properties of wool while maintaining the original fit of the socks.

Special Considerations for Different Wool Types

Not all wool is the same, and various types of wool may react differently to washing and drying:

  • Merino Wool: Fine and soft, merino wool is more delicate and prone to shrinkage if treated roughly. It benefits from gentle handling and cool water.
  • Shetland Wool: Coarser and more resilient, Shetland wool may tolerate slightly more agitation but still requires care to avoid felting.
  • Alpaca and Cashmere: Though not technically wool, these fibers share similar shrinkage risks and should be washed delicately.
  • Blended Wool: Wool blended with synthetic fibers usually shrinks less but still requires appropriate care to maintain shape and size.

Understanding the fiber type helps tailor the washing routine to minimize damage and shrinkage.

Signs Your Wool Socks Have Shrunk

Recognizing shrinkage early can help you adjust your care routine or decide whether the socks can still be comfortably worn. Common signs include:

  • Noticeably tighter fit around the foot or ankle.
  • Shorter length leading to socks slipping off the heel.
  • Increased fabric density or stiffness.
  • Visible puckering or bunching in the knit.

If these signs appear, it is often impossible to restore the original size, highlighting the importance of preventative care.

Conditions That Cause Wool Socks to Shrink

Wool socks are particularly prone to shrinking when subjected to specific environmental and laundering conditions. Below is a detailed overview of factors that contribute to shrinkage:

Condition Effect on Wool Socks Explanation
High Washing Temperature Significant shrinkage Hot water causes wool fibers to swell and scales to lift, promoting felting.
Mechanical Agitation Increased shrinkage Friction during washing causes fibers to rub against each other, facilitating scale interlocking.
High Heat Drying Possible shrinkage and deformation Heat from dryers can tighten fiber bonds and further contract the fabric.
Improper Detergents Potential fiber damage Harsh detergents can roughen fibers, increasing friction and shrinkage risk.
Repeated Washing Cumulative shrinkage Each wash cycle can progressively cause more felting and shrinkage.

To minimize shrinkage, controlling washing temperature, reducing agitation, and avoiding high heat drying are critical.

Best Practices to Prevent Wool Sock Shrinkage

Maintaining the original size and shape of wool socks requires careful attention to laundering techniques and handling. The following best practices are recommended by textile experts:

  • Use cold or lukewarm water: Wash wool socks in water below 30°C (86°F) to prevent fiber swelling and scale lifting.
  • Choose gentle wash cycles or hand wash: Minimize mechanical agitation by selecting delicate machine cycles or washing by hand.
  • Use wool-specific or mild detergents: These detergents are formulated to clean without damaging the fiber cuticles.
  • Avoid bleach and fabric softeners: Chemicals that degrade wool fibers increase shrinkage risk.
  • Air dry flat: Lay socks on a flat surface away from direct sunlight and heat sources to maintain shape and prevent contraction.
  • Do not tumble dry: High heat and tumbling action exacerbate felting and shrinkage.
  • Store properly: Fold wool socks carefully and avoid stretching to preserve fiber integrity.

Effect of Wool Sock Construction on Shrinkage Potential

The construction and composition of wool socks influence their susceptibility to shrinkage. Key considerations include:

Factor Impact on Shrinkage Details
Wool Type (Merino, Shetland, etc.) Varies Finer wool fibers like Merino have softer scales and may felt less aggressively than coarser wools.
Blend Composition Reduced shrinkage if blended Blends with synthetic fibers (e.g., nylon, polyester) reduce felting by interrupting fiber scale interlocking.
Knit Density Denser knits shrink less Tightly knit socks have less room for fibers to move and felt during washing.
Pre-shrunk Wool Minimal shrinkage Wool that has undergone controlled shrinking processes is more dimensionally stable.
